Understanding Orthotic Insoles

Orthotic insoles are special shoe inserts made to support your feet. They can be custom-made or pre-made. Some people use them to relieve foot pain or improve posture. Others like them for added comfort. Not all feet are the same, so insoles can be customized. They help with conditions like flat feet or high arches. You can find insoles in most shoe stores. Pros Cons
Improves comfort and support. Can be costly to customize.
Helps correct foot position. Might not fit all shoe types.
Reduces foot pain. Requires proper maintenance.
Improves posture and balance. Some need regular replacement.

Question: How long do orthotic insoles last?

Answer: The lifespan of insoles depends on their material and use. Custom insoles can last up to five years. Store-bought ones might need replacement every six months to a year.

Question: Can insoles fit all types of shoes?

Answer: Not all insoles fit every shoe type. Some insoles are bulkier and might not work with snug shoes. It’s important to choose insoles based on your shoe type.
